Ms Susan Tappenden - Lecturer

LLB (Hons) LLM (Legal Theory & History) UCL

Sue Tappenden joined Te Piringa - Faculty of Law in 2001 after ten years as an academic in the UK. Prior to that she spent seven years as a teacher at a bilingual college in Hong Kong. She has experience in commercial law but mainly lectures in equity and property law and she has a special interest in jurisprudence. Sue obtained her LLM at University College, London.

Her research interests include property, equity and jurisprudence plus the teaching of skills in the undergraduate programme.
